2.16 What is the role of CRA?

Chandhar Arvind

The Canada Revenue Agency plays an important role as an administrator of the Canadian taxation system.

CRA keeps a check on:

  1. Payroll
  2. GST/HST
  3. Income Tax
  4. Excise Tax/Duties
  5. Business Number Registration

The CRA has the authority to audit any company, corporation or individual to ensure they are compliant with Canadian tax law.

Effectively, the CRA plays the role of tax police. They enforce tax law and can penalize or charge you (through tax reassessments); however, you can challenge them in court if you disagree with their claim.

Interactive Content

Author: Afeef Khan, June 2019

Interactive Content

Author: Satbir Brar, January 2020

References and Resources:

What is the role of CRA?” from Introductory Canadian Tax Copyright © 2021 by Chandhar Arvind is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License, except where otherwise noted.


Icon for the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License

Tax and Tax Planning Copyright © 2021 by Chandhar Arvind is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License, except where otherwise noted.

Share This Book